I really did not know much about Jan Peerce, only few recordings, what I did not know is that he had such a long career and his voice was  pretty fit even in his late 70’s, when he was still very active. Thanks to the internet I found few interviews and, what an interesting man, beautiful voice, and somehow very nice speaking voice as well, very unique, like I could hear him for hours on the radio if he would have a radio show, you can tell the way he speaks, that he was a very good story teller. His life is really interesting and he, like many great singers, where discovered by some conductor, business management, colleague, in his case by the only “Toscanini”.

This year on my visits to Parma, I saw the house of Toscanini. He was famous for being temperamental. Privately however, Jan Peerce has very fond memories of him and only spoke good about him, and that his short temper was also very quick down. Meaning, after the shouting he quickly also forgot about it, Peerce said he never hold any grudge, so he says. Jan Peerce, was a very stoic man and one can see the way he speaks and talks about other people.
